Blocking on this. The planner regression reintroduces the nested-loop fallback that the Ostrel team removed last cycle — any plugin issuing joins over the hinted path will see quadratic scans again. Your change resets the cost thresholds to upstream defaults, which is wrong for Carvet deployments. Either restore the overrides or gate them behind a config flag plugin authors can read. Also add a regression test against the fixture catalog. For reference, the thresholds we shipped and expect to keep are these.

limits module of fajog-tawig:
RATE_LIMITS = {
    "druwyn": 2,
    "quenael": 10,
    "wenix": 2,
    "druael": 2,
}

Ticket: Template rendering latency in Quillport's invoice module has crept past 400ms at p95. We traced the regression to unbounded partial lookups introduced in the Larchwood refactor. Proposed fix caches compiled templates per tenant, with eviction after 15 minutes. Future maintainers: see the benchmark harness under tools/render-bench before modifying. Sign-off is required from the engineer named below.

named custodian: Belius Casath Ulaix Sorius

## Authentication

Heads up: the nightly reindex job (`reindex_nightly.py`) talks to the Lanternfish search cluster, and that cluster won't accept anonymous writes anymore — we locked it down last sprint. The job now authenticates as the `reindex-runner` service identity against Corvid Gateway, and the token is injected via the `LF_INDEX_TOKEN` env var in the scheduler config. Nothing clever going on, just a bearer header on every batch request. For review purposes, the staging credential currently in use is listed below.

service key, kadug-kadup: kto15_rN23XLAYImmZgrJ